Born Jenna Marie Ortega on September 27, 2002, in Palm Desert, California, the actress, the fourth of six siblings, has quickly ascended to prominence. Her father, a former sheriff who now works in a California district attorney's office, is of Mexican descent, while her mother, of Mexican and Puerto Rican heritage, works as an emergency room nurse. This rich cultural tapestry has provided Ortega with a unique perspective, which she skillfully integrates into her portrayal of Wednesday Addams.

In the upcoming Netflix series, fittingly titled 'Wednesday' and directed by the visionary Tim Burton, Ortega takes on the central role, bringing the enigmatic daughter of the Addams family to life. The series, a supernatural mystery comedy, delves into Wednesday Addams' years as a student at Nevermore Academy, where she grapples with her emerging psychic abilities, attempts to thwart a killing spree, and unravels the mysteries that have entangled her parents. The show's creators, Alfred Gough and Miles Millar, have masterfully adapted Charles Addams' iconic character. The series, enriched by the creative vision of Tim Burton, stars an ensemble cast including Gwendoline Christie, Riki Lindhome, Jamie McShane, Hunter Doohan, Percy Hynes White, Emma Myers, Joy Sunday, Georgie Farmer, Naomi J. Ogawa, Christina Ricci, and Moosa. In interviews, Ortega, along with Tim Burton, Alfred Gough, and Miles Millar, has offered tantalizing glimpses into what viewers can expect from the show.
